Because m ∠1 + m ∠2 = 180 ° and m ∠5 + m ∠6 = 180° (because adjacent … chuggington wooden railway kokoWebTheorem. In mathematics, a theorem is a statement that has been proved, or can be proved. [a] [2] [3] The proof of a theorem is a logical argument that uses the inference rules of a deductive system to establish that the theorem is a logical consequence of the axioms and previously proved theorems.
